AMBARI-7498. HiveServer2 still throwing Transport Errors (aonishuk)
Project: http://git-wip-us.apache.org/repos/asf/ambari/repo Commit: http://git-wip-us.apache.org/repos/asf/ambari/commit/31466943 Tree: http://git-wip-us.apache.org/repos/asf/ambari/tree/31466943 Diff: http://git-wip-us.apache.org/repos/asf/ambari/diff/31466943 Branch: refs/heads/branch-alerts-dev Commit: 314669431c0643ded210a6e65ec3243c97fde101 Parents: 5a15422 Author: Andrew Onishuk <[email protected]> Authored: Thu Sep 25 22:27:08 2014 +0300 Committer: Andrew Onishuk <[email protected]> Committed: Thu Sep 25 22:27:08 2014 +0300 ---------------------------------------------------------------------- .../stacks/HDP/1.3.2/services/HIVE/package/scripts/hive_service.py | 1 + .../stacks/HDP/1.3.2/services/HIVE/package/scripts/service_check.py | 1 + .../stacks/HDP/2.0.6/services/HIVE/package/scripts/hive_service.py | 1 + .../stacks/HDP/2.0.6/services/HIVE/package/scripts/service_check.py | 1 + 4 files changed, 4 insertions(+)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ambari/blob/31466943/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/hive_service.py ---------------------------------------------------------------------- diff --git a/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/hive_service.py b/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/hive_service.py index bea7c3d..c58dff5 100644 --- a/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/hive_service.py +++ b/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/hive_service.py @@ -76,6 +76,7 @@ def hive_service( while time.time() < end_time: try: s.connect((address, port)) + s.send("A001 AUTHENTICATE ANONYMOUS") is_service_socket_valid = True break except socket.error, e: http://git-wip-us.apache.org/repos/asf/ambari/blob/31466943/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/service_check.py ---------------------------------------------------------------------- diff --git a/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/service_check.py b/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/service_check.py index d7b10eb..69bc33a 100644 --- a/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/service_check.py +++ b/ambari-server/src/main/resources/stacks/HDP/1.3.2/services/HIVE/package/scripts/service_check.py @@ -36,6 +36,7 @@ class HiveServiceCheck(Script): print "Test connectivity to hive server" try: s.connect((address, port)) + s.send("A001 AUTHENTICATE ANONYMOUS") print "Successfully connected to %s on port %s" % (address, port) s.close() except socket.error, e: http://git-wip-us.apache.org/repos/asf/ambari/blob/31466943/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/hive_service.py ---------------------------------------------------------------------- diff --git a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/hive_service.py b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/hive_service.py index d5a1785..cfcdd9a 100644 --- a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/hive_service.py +++ b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/hive_service.py @@ -82,6 +82,7 @@ def hive_service( while time.time() < end_time: try: s.connect((address, port)) + s.send("A001 AUTHENTICATE ANONYMOUS") is_service_socket_valid = True break except socket.error, e: http://git-wip-us.apache.org/repos/asf/ambari/blob/31466943/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/service_check.py ---------------------------------------------------------------------- diff --git a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/service_check.py b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/service_check.py index d7b10eb..69bc33a 100644 --- a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/service_check.py +++ b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/service_check.py @@ -36,6 +36,7 @@ class HiveServiceCheck(Script): print "Test connectivity to hive server" try: s.connect((address, port)) + s.send("A001 AUTHENTICATE ANONYMOUS") print "Successfully connected to %s on port %s" % (address, port) s.close() except socket.error, e:
